Role Purpose
To ensure product quality during the manufacturing process by monitoring, controlling, and improving in-process parameters. The role focuses on defect prevention, process adherence, and real-time quality assurance to achieve zero-defect production.
Key Responsibilities 1. In-Process Quality Control
- Perform stage-wise inspections across production lines (incoming → assembly → final stages).
- Monitor critical process parameters and ensure adherence to SOPs and control plans.
- Conduct patrol inspection and line audits to identify deviations.
- Approve first-off samples and in-process checkpoints.
2. Defect Identification & Control
- Identify defects at early stages and prevent further propagation.
- Implement containment actions for quality issues on the shop floor.
- Maintain rejection, rework, and defect data.
3. Root Cause Analysis & Problem Solving
- Perform RCA using tools like:
- Fishbone (Ishikawa)
- 5 Why Analysis
- Pareto Analysis
- Drive corrective and preventive actions (CAPA).
- Work closely with production and engineering teams to eliminate recurring issues.
4. Process Quality Assurance
- Ensure adherence to:
- Control Plans
- Process Flow
- Work Instructions
- Validate process changes and engineering modifications.
- Support current product introduction (NPI) and pilot runs.
